Job Summary:
We are seeking a skilled and experienced Camp Cook to join our team and prepare delicious and nutritious meals for our campers, staff, and community programs. The ideal candidate will have a passion for cooking and a talent for creating flavorful and diverse menus that cater to different dietary requirements. As a Head Cook, you will be responsible for planning, preparing, and serving meals for large groups of people in a rustic outdoor setting.


Key Responsibilities:

  • Create meal plans that meet the dietary requirements and preferences of campers, staff, and community programs
  • Prepare and cook meals in a timely and efficient manner, using high-quality, fresh ingredients
  • Maintain a clean and organized kitchen and dining area
  • Ensure that all food is stored and handled safely and hygienically
  • Order and receive supplies and food deliveries as needed
  • Keep inventory of kitchen supplies and equipment, and report any needs for repair or replacement
  • Manage a small team of kitchen assistants and/or volunteers, assigning tasks and supervising their work
  • Monitor food consumption and waste to minimize expenses and ensure that there is enough food for everyone
  • Participate in all camp activities and events as required, including preparing and serving meals for special events
  • Follow all health and safety regulations and guidelines


Qualifications:

 

  • Proven experience as a cook in a camp, resort, or other hospitality setting
  • Strong knowledge of food safety and hygiene practices
  • Ability to cook for large groups of people with varying dietary needs and preferences  Must be physically fit, no issues with standing and able to lift average 50 lbs
  • Excellent communication and leadership skills, with the ability to manage and motivate a team
  • Strong organizational and time-management skills
  • Ability to work in a fast-paced, dynamic environment
  • A passion for cooking and creating delicious and nutritious meals
  • Flexibility and adaptability to work long hours, including early mornings, late evenings and some weekends
  • Valid food handling and safety certification is a plus
